Output 67943d7ace858b3f82a02537c5690118a36bf249dbef50fc47f4f15e32b03d9e:0

value
1998274932
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83ddc6c6b9ca56a03bc47c90283f59e22c858e68 OP_EQUAL
address
3DiG7yNmWrhNM6NtGuhsFxAU69cLJAbqHy
transaction
67943d7ace858b3f82a02537c5690118a36bf249dbef50fc47f4f15e32b03d9e
spent
true